NAME

       Voronota - software for Voronoi tessellation-based analysis of macromolecular structures

DESCRIPTION

       The  analysis  of  macromolecular  structures often requires a comprehensive definition of
       atomic neighborhoods.  Such a definition can be based on the  Voronoi  diagram  of  balls,
       where  each  ball represents an atom of some van der Waals radius.  Voronota is a software
       tool for finding all the  vertices  of  the  Voronoi  diagram  of  balls.   Such  vertices
       correspond  to  the  centers  of the empty tangent spheres defined by quadruples of balls.
       Voronota is especially suitable for processing three-dimensional structures of  biological
       macromolecules such as proteins and RNA.

       Since  version 1.2 Voronota also uses the Voronoi vertices to construct inter-atom contact
       surfaces and solvent accessible surfaces.  Voronota  provides  tools  to  query  contacts,
       generate  contacts  graphics,  compare contacts and evaluate quality of protein structural
       models using contacts.

       The list of all available Voronota commands is displayed when executing  Voronota  without
       any parameters.

       Command help is shown when --help command line option is present, for example:

              voronota calculate-vertices --help

       Using --help option without specific command results in printing help for all commands:

              voronota --help

       There are several Voronota wrapper scripts, their interfaces can displayed similarly:

              voronota-voromqa --help
              voronota-cadscore --help
              voronota-contacts --help
              voronota-volumes --help
              voronota-pocket --help
              voronota-membrane --help
